French WW transitplate

About this product

For vehicles that do not have a valid registration or a valid Dutch roadworthiness certificate (APK), you can make use of the French WW plate, also known as the French transit plate. This temporary plate is valid for 4 months and is supplied with temporary third-party (WA) insurance valid for 14 days. If you wish to keep driving on the plate after those 14 days, you will need to arrange follow-up third-party insurance yourself through your own insurer. The plate is intended for vehicles that are being exported and driven by road to their destination country.

Please note: applications can only be submitted by businesses.

This plate is intended solely for a one-way trip from A to B, to or from France. Registration in another country is not possible with this plate; the original vehicle documents are required for that.

A valid roadworthiness certificate (APK/MOT/CT) is not required for issuing this plate. Responsibility for the safety and technical condition of the vehicle during the trip always lies with the buyer/driver.

Documents required for your application
Your application can only be processed once the documents below have been submitted. We only accept clear, legible PDF scans:

  • Copy of the sales invoice

  • Copy of the registration document (for used vehicles)

  • Certificate of Conformity (CoC) (for new vehicles)

  • Copy of the driver's ID

  • Driver's full name and address details

Please note: the plate is issued to the chassis number provided by the applicant. As a result, an order cannot be cancelled or returned once it has been submitted.

Order information

  • The French WW plate can only be requested for trucks, buses, and trailers of European origin.

  • The sales invoice must be addressed to a business; registration in the name of a private individual is not possible. An EORI number may additionally be requested.

  • The start date of the plate and its accompanying insurance (14 days) defaults to the date of the order, unless you indicate otherwise.

  • If you order before 12:00 (noon), your application will be processed the same working day.

    • The plates and insurance policy will be sent that same day to the address provided.

  • Vinacles cannot be held liable for delays or errors caused by courier services.

Regulations and use

  • Please note! The French WW plate does not qualify for an exemption from the Dutch heavy goods vehicle charge (vrachtwagenheffing). If you drive on this plate within the Netherlands, you will therefore need an OBU (On Board Unit).

  • For vehicles of Dutch origin, the Dutch export plate is a possible alternative.

  • The plate may only be used for trips to or from France, via a logical and reasonably shortest route.

  • This temporary plate is registered in EUCARIS. Its validity can also be checked via the French government's website: Demande de certificat de situation administrative.

  • Incorrect or unauthorized use may result in action by local authorities. Vinacles does not provide legal support in such situations.
